Bernd Friedrich
Bernd Friedrich, 67, is a former miner who has been significantly affected by the economic transitions following German reunification. He, along with Manfred Stern, founded the Mansfeld Museum to preserve the memory and legacy of their industrial work, highlighting the socio-economic struggles and sentiments of loss experienced by many in East Germany.
